The cybersecurity landscape for managed service providers (MSPs) and midmarket businesses is undergoing a seismic shift. As cyber threats grow in sophistication and frequency, the demand for proactive, AI-driven security solutions is surging. N-able's Anomaly Detection as a Service (ADaaS), integrated into its Cove Data Protection platform, is emerging as a pivotal tool for MSPs seeking to dominate this $610 billion managed services market by 2025 N-able’s John Pagliuca on Key Trends Driving MSP Growth in 2025[3]. With 90% of surveyed MSPs anticipating growth in cybersecurity managed services sales this year—up from 80% in 2024—N-able's ADaaS is not just a product but a strategic lever for competitive differentiation N-able’s Second Annual MSP Horizons Report Shows Significant Growth Opportunity for Global MSPs with Cybersecurity Leading the Way[1].

The ADaaS Edge: Proactive Defense in a Reactive World

Traditional cybersecurity models rely on reactive measures, but N-able's ADaaS redefines the paradigm by embedding detection and response into the data protection lifecycle. Features like Honeypots—always-on mechanisms that mimic vulnerable systems to lure attackers—allow early identification of brute-force attacks and unauthorized access attempts before they compromise production systems or backups N-able’s Second Annual MSP Horizons Report Shows Significant Growth Opportunity for Global MSPs with Cybersecurity Leading the Way[1]. This proactive approach transforms backup from a passive safety net into an active defense layer, offering midmarket organizations enterprise-grade protection without the overhead of dedicated security teams.

For MSPs, this translates to a unique value proposition: the ability to deliver cyber resiliency as a unified service. By integrating ADaaS with monitoring, management, and security operations, N-ableNABL-- enables MSPs to address threats across the entire attack lifecycle—protection, detection, response, and recovery N-able Wants MSPs to 'Pick Their Cybersecurity Journey'[2]. This holistic strategy aligns with the industry's growing emphasis on compliance and risk management, positioning ADaaS as a revenue driver and a trust-building tool for clients N-able’s Second Annual MSP Horizons Report Shows Significant Growth Opportunity for Global MSPs with Cybersecurity Leading the Way[1].

Strategic Competitive Advantage in a $610 Billion Market

The IT managed services market's projected 2025 size—$610 billion, with 98% of revenue generated by channel partners—underscores the urgency for MSPs to specialize in high-margin cybersecurity services N-able’s John Pagliuca on Key Trends Driving MSP Growth in 2025[3]. N-able's ADaaS addresses this need by lowering the barrier to entry for advanced security capabilities. Smaller MSPs, which might lack the resources to invest in standalone security tools, can now offer enterprise-level protection through N-able's platform, leveling the playing field against larger competitors N-able Wants MSPs to 'Pick Their Cybersecurity Journey'[2].

Moreover, AI adoption is accelerating this shift. With 94% of MSPs already leveraging generative AI for workflow automation and sales optimization MSP Industry Set for Major Growth through 2025: N-able[4], N-able's ADaaS integrates seamlessly into AI-driven operations. For instance, AI-powered backup and recovery—a top future demand in managed services—are embedded into ADaaS, enabling MSPs to future-proof their offerings while reducing operational costs N-able Wants MSPs to 'Pick Their Cybersecurity Journey'[2].

Market Validation and Future Outlook

N-able's Second Annual MSP Horizons Report, conducted with Canalys, highlights a clear trend: cybersecurity-related services will dominate revenue growth over the next three years, with third-party managed detection and response (MDR) services leading the charge N-able’s Second Annual MSP Horizons Report Shows Significant Growth Opportunity for Global MSPs with Cybersecurity Leading the Way[1]. ADaaS's focus on MDR and threat mitigation positions it at the intersection of these trends.

Investors should also note the broader market dynamics. As cyber resilience becomes a boardroom priority, organizations are willing to pay a premium for solutions that simplify compliance and reduce downtime. N-able's ADaaS, with its emphasis on proactive threat detection and recovery, directly addresses these pain points. For MSPs, this means higher client retention and upsell opportunities—critical in a market where 90% of surveyed providers expect cybersecurity sales growth N-able’s Second Annual MSP Horizons Report Shows Significant Growth Opportunity for Global MSPs with Cybersecurity Leading the Way[1].
